    There is something GW has never quite figured out, and it's called "Perceived Value." People don't buy Warhammer models, they invest in them. They're expensive in terms of both out-of-pocket cost, but also the cost of learning the rules, assembly and painting, and practice. When they pull a stunt like this, the Perceived Value of the Stormcast models drops like a stone, and people justifiably get upset. They feel like they just lost something of value - money, time, whatever. The investment is not as valuable.

      @nilsirrah, I have always used my airbrush in the room with my computer, I got a clear plastic sheet I throw over the monitors and I put a piece of cardboard over the top vent on the pc (with some little feet made from blu tack) so paint dust doesn’t fall in.
      Airbrush spray basically turns to dust about 1m from the nozzle, so there’s no additional humidity created. Just get a mask, I don’t care what anyone says about acrylics being food safe don’t breathe that shit in, ever. It does leave a slightly sweet smell in the air (the aerosolized paint medium) for about 30m-60m after.

      Chronic Eosinophilic Pneumonia is a, rare, disease associated with air brush painting. Inhaling aerosolised acrylic paint is not healthy: two thin coats of paint on the inside of your lungs is not good for them.
      Wear a mask and use a painting booth that extracts outside the room. I use one with the hose going out a window.
